Examining the ingredients in natural cleaning products

When it comes to examining the ingredients in natural cleaning solutions, it is important to note that they are typically made from plant-derived materials such as surfactants, enzymes, and essential oils. Surfactants help break down dirt and grease by reducing the surface tension of water molecules so that they can more easily penetrate particles. Enzymes are proteins that act like catalysts to speed up chemical reactions for breaking down dirt and grease, while essential oils give natural cleaners their fragrant aroma. All of these ingredients work together to provide a safe yet effective cleaning solution without the need for harsh chemicals or artificial fragrances.

In addition to these core ingredients, many eco-friendly cleaning products also contain additional plant-based elements such as baking soda, vinegar, lemon juice, lemon oil, and even salt. Baking soda is known for its powerful deodorizing properties while vinegar is an all-purpose cleaner suitable for removing dirt, grease, and grime from surfaces. Lemon juice provides additional antibacterial power while salt acts as a scrubbing agent which can help loosen stubborn stains and debris. All of these additional ingredients help make natural cleaning products to the next level by providing a safe and effective way of keeping your home clean without sacrificing performance or results.

What to look for when choosing environmentally friendly cleaning products

When it comes to choosing environmentally friendly cleaning products, there are a few key things to keep in mind. First and foremost, it is important to look for products made from natural, renewable materials whenever possible as these tend to be better for the environment than synthetic alternatives. Natural cleaners like vinegar, baking soda, and lemon juice are effective, non-toxic solutions that can reduce your reliance on harsh chemicals making them an excellent choice for eco-conscious consumers.

In addition to natural ingredients, it is also important to pay attention to packaging. Choose items that come with minimal or no packaging whenever possible opting for concentrated formulas or refillable bottles or refill pouches, instead of single-use containers. Additionally, look out for companies that use biodegradable materials such as paper or corn starch in their packaging helping to reduce waste while also keeping your home clean!

Another factor to consider when selecting green cleaning products is the products water footprint. This refers to the amount of water used in the production process and indicates how much energy and resources were required for its manufacture. Generally speaking, natural cleaners tend to have lower water footprints than traditional synthetic counterparts due their efficient manufacturing processes. Furthermore, some products are even designed specifically with conservation in mind - using recycled materials or compostable components in order to reduce environmental impact even further!

Finally, be sure to check the label of any cleaning product you buy looking out for certifications from organizations such as Green Seal and EcoLogo which certify that a product meets certain standards of sustainability.
